Transaction 9e888fec3ffa7a09022d6854ebfb3795483355623eb807aa95a3c3803e683598
1 Input
1 Output
-
9e888fec3ffa7a09022d6854ebfb3795483355623eb807aa95a3c3803e683598:0
- value
- 358735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76bef31624f3a1eb78f204736df6c44a8b1d4dad OP_EQUAL
- address
- 3CWtQb2iGjDHLJEdxMEe8BzUshnBRHwZh8